PRO NMEA 0183 Multiplexer/NMEA 2000 Gateway

Interconnectivity, reimagined!

The PRO-NDC-1E2K is much more than an NMEA 0183 Multiplexer…

Rugged, Robust, Type Approved Multiplexer with built-in NMEA 2000 connectivity, high-speed Ethernet streaming of data, flexible configuration, auto-switching and sentence level filtering.

Managing and routing your NMEA data is straight forward, hassle free using the PRO-NDC-1E2K

Features:

  • Auto-switching between inputs to allow for a primary, secondary, tertiary priority input.
  • Configurable baud rates to allow 38400 and 4800 baud devices to operate through the same multiplexer.
  • Sentence filtering to block unwanted sentences from specific outputs helps to limit bandwidth consumption.
  • Easy to configure using the web based UI, no need to manually enter and edit strings of text.
  • RINA type approved device means the multiplexer is fit for leisure, commercial and class / type installations.
  • Multiple LED’s allow for ‘quick glance’ diagnostics to ensure everything is operating correctly.
  • Certified NMEA 2000 device connectivity allows for conversion and output of data onto NMEA 2000 network.
  • Bi-directional conversion to and from N2K Network allows for seamless integration between legacy and new equipment.
  • NMEA 0183 data streaming over Ethernet enables connectivity to existing Ethernet devices and systems.
  • NMEA 2000 data streaming over Ethernet.
  • 5 OPTO-Isolated NMEA 0183 inputs and 2 ISO-Drive NMEA 0183 outputs provide protection for all connected instruments.

Technical Specifications:

Power Supply

  • Input supply voltage - 9 to 35 V DC
  • Input supply current - 150mA max @ 12V DC (all outputs @ full drive into 100 ohm loads)
  • Input protection - Continuous reverse polarity, transient overvoltage and ESD protection
  • Power indicator - LED, Blue – indicates unit is functioning correctly
  • Input Supply connector - Pluggable 2-way screw terminal, 5.08mm pitch (12 to 30 AWG)

NMEA 0183 Port – Listener & Talker

  • Number of Listener / Input Ports - 5 isolated NMEA 0183 Listeners
  • Number of Talker / Output Ports - 2 isolated NMEA 0183 Talkers
  • Compatibility - Fully NMEA 0183, RS422 & RS232 compatible. RS485 Listener compatible
  • Speed / baud rate - 4800 to 38400 bps
  • Talker Output Voltage Drive - >= 2.2V (differential) into 100 ohm
  • Talker Output Current Drive - 20 mA maximum per output
  • Talker Output Protection - Short circuit and ESD
  • Talker Data Indicator - LED, Orange (Flashes with data rate)
  • Listener Input Voltage Tolerance - -15 V to +15 V continuous, -35 V to +35 V short term (< 1 second)
  • Listener Input Protection - Current limited, overdrive protection to 40 VDC and ESD protection
  • Listener Data Indicator - LED, Green (Flashes with data rate)
  • Connectors - Pluggable 2/3 way screw terminals, 5.08mm pitch (12 to 30 AWG)

Serial Port

  • Compatibility - RS422 & RS232 compatible. RS485 Listener compatible
  • Speed / baud rate - 115200 bps
  • Output voltage drive - >= 2.1V (differential) into 100 ohm
  • Output current drive - 20 mA max.
  • Output protection - Short circuit and ESD
  • Input voltage tolerance - -15 V to +15 V continuous, -35 V to +35 V short term (< 1 second)
  • Input protection - Current limited, overdrive protection to 40 VDC and ESD protection
  • Data Indicators - LED’s: Green = Receive, Orange = Transmit
  • Connectors - Pluggable 3-way screw terminals, 5.08mm pitch (12 to 30 AWG)

Ethernet Port

  • Host interface - 10/100BaseT, automatic polarity detection
  • Supported protocols - TCP/IP for configuration and firmware updating, TCP/IP and UDP for NMEA 0183 comms
  • Connector - RJ45
  • Indicators - Green – Link, Yellow – 100 Mbps

NMEA 2000 Port

  • Compatibility - NMEA 2000 Certification Pending
  • Speed / baud rate - 250 kbps
  • Connectivity - M12 male (A-coded) connector

Isolation

  • NMEA 0183 Listener - Uses IsoDriveTM, Hi-Pot tested to 1000V
  • NMEA 0183 Talker - Uses IsoDriveTM, Hi-Pot tested to 1000V
  • Serial Port - Uses IsoDriveTM, Hi-Pot tested to 1000V
  • Ethernet Port - 2kv for 60s
  • NMEA 2000 Port - OPTO-Isolated, Hi-Pot tested to 1000V

Mechanical

  • Housing Material - 316 Stainless Steel
  • Dimensions - 139mm (W) x 98mm (H) x 26mm (D)
  • Weight - 360g
  • Mounting - Bulkhead mount or DIN rail mount (DIN kit 1)

Approvals and Certifications

  • EMC - IEC 60945:2002-08, DNVGL-CG-0339:2019 & IACS UR E10 Rev7
  • Compass Safe Distance - 300mm
  • Type Approval Certificate - RINA
  • Operating Temperature - -25 to +70°C
  • Storage Temperature - -40 to +85°C
  • Relative Humidity (RH) - 95% @ 55°C
  • Environmental Protection - IP40
  • Guarantee - 5 Years when registered
